Tsutsu-um Shrine place

Tsutsu-um Shrine is located in the Hyrule Field region west-southwest of Hyrule Field Skyview Tower, just beyond the ruins of the Coliseum.

The exact coordinates are (-1422, -1350, 0068).


Tsutsu-um Shrine puzzle solution

In Tsutsu-um Shrine, you use posts and panels attached to posts to guide a ball into a hole. (It sounds simpler than it is.)

1. There’s a lot to expect when you walk into Tsutsu-um Shrine, but we’ll take it in steps.

2. On the left side there is a panel on the floor next to a combination of panel and post. There is also a piston hanging from the ceiling that moves up and down. Grab the panel with Ultrahand and place it on the post protruding from the left side of the piston.

3. Take the panel pole and insert it into the piston when it is at the lowest point — this creates a platform that you can ride on like an elevator.

4. Climb it and ride it. Drop onto the platform behind the piston. Pull both panel pin assemblies off the piston and carry them to the right past the updraft vent, then place them on the metal platform in front of the large spinning wheel.

5. Ride the updraft up and slide to the pillar behind the piston to get a chest with a bundle of arrows inside.

6. Ride the updraft back up and direct your glide toward the metal platform further to the right. There is a second, smaller metal platform above the larger one – that’s where you go.

7. Your goal here is to position the panels and posts so that the ball is directed down the ramp and then onto the big wheel.

8. Look at the wall directly in front of the chute where the ball comes out. There is a pole there – you can leave it there. Grab one of the panel posts and turn it 45° (or 90°) clockwise to stop the ball.

9. Grab one of the posts and place it to pin the spinning rock seesaw in place so that it slopes to the right.

10. You may have to adjust the positions a bit, but this will direct the ball into the bin in front of the big wheel.

11. Once the ball is in the bin, take one of the ring-panel combinations.

12. Place the ring-panel combination horizontally in the rotating wheel on the left (at the 9 o’clock position). The goal here is to get it to sweep through the bowl and push the ball into the bowl.

13. If the ball is pushed into the bowl on the far right, it will roll into its hole and open the gate on the right.

14. Go through to pick you up Light of blessing and leave.
